Transaction 14523a8398651ccf0800259f55ceb1eea32422d7bce86883de99d36885ff8c62
1 Input
1 Output
-
14523a8398651ccf0800259f55ceb1eea32422d7bce86883de99d36885ff8c62:0
- value
- 95776
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3265562cc25d1974bce56ff099b55e6364d5151 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LFTVwMhLqD22r7oyfaFAcNQZ2zqw7S7H8